Output dbbb32a88db8947e3c61fb91eacc33f74eb895f1342358597addc8634117118b:5

value
47921082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48a2d48ca44341aa45c7157b758408892d64075b OP_EQUAL
address
MEXDwtRyNhKqcmf77WhR7mngURzhtBd1pK
transaction
dbbb32a88db8947e3c61fb91eacc33f74eb895f1342358597addc8634117118b
spent
true